FIGURE 2 in Polka-dotted treasures: Revising a clade of ascidian- and bivalve-associated shrimps (Caridea: Palaemonidae)

FIGURE 2 Phylogeny reconstruction based on the MrBayes tree topology of the TE approach. RAxML bootstrap support and Bayesian posterior probabilities expressed as percentages are indicated respectively. Dashes (--) indicate values <50; asterisk (*) indicates different topology of RAxML or MrBayes tree. Barcodes are indicated by a collection accession number (RMNH.CRUS.D.) or a GenBank accession number. Species are listed in the appendices (supplementary table S1). Species of which only morphological data was analysed are indicated with an asterisk (*) and no accession number. Colours indicate various host associations. Zenopontonia rex (Kemp, 1922) is represented as a symbiont with two main host associations: holothurians and nudibranchs.

FIGURE 3 in Polka-dotted treasures: Revising a clade of ascidian- and bivalve-associated shrimps (Caridea: Palaemonidae)

FIGURE 3 Phylogeny reconstruction based on the MrBayes tree topology of the TE approach (fig. 2), with ancestral character state reconstructions on the internal nodes (probabilities are shown as pie charts). Colours indicate various host associations, both for the species as well as the ancestral character states. Zenopontonia rex (Kemp, 1922) is represented as a symbiont with two kinds of host associations (holothurians and nudibranchs), but was only classified as an echinoderm associate in the analysis. Species of which only morphological data was analysed are indicated with an asterisk next to the species names (*).
